WASHINGTON – Senate Judiciary Committee Chairman Chuck Grassley (R-Iowa) and Ranking Member Dick Durbin (D-Ill.) are reintroducing bipartisan legislation to reform and close loopholes in the H-1B and L-1 visa programs. The H-1B and L-1 Visa Reform Act targets fraud and abuse in our immigration system, provides protections for American workers and visa...

BUTLER COUNTY, IOWA – Sen. Chuck Grassley (R-Iowa) joined Senate Foreign Relations Committee Chairman Jim Risch (R-Idaho) and Sen. Sheldon Whitehouse (D-R.I.) to introduce the REPO Implementation Act of 2025.
The bipartisan legislation would repurpose frozen Russian sovereign assets held in the United States for transfer to Ukraine every 90 days. The...
